What are IT Consultancy Services?
IT consultancy services provide businesses with expert advice, strategies, and solutions to improve their technology infrastructure and operations. These services are typically delivered by third-party consultants or IT firms, such as Callnet Solution, specializing in areas like cloud integration, cybersecurity, infrastructure management, and software development.
For small businesses, IT consultants act as trusted advisors, helping to align technology with business goals while addressing key challenges like limited budgets, outdated systems, and emerging security threats.

Five Common Types of IT Services in Malaysia
Small businesses in Malaysia often require tailored IT consultancy services to navigate the complexities of technology and remain competitive. Here are some of the most relevant services and how they can help small businesses thrive:
1. IT Strategy Planning
A well-thought-out IT strategy ensures your technology investments align with your business objectives and growth plans. IT strategy planning typically includes:
- Developing a Technology Roadmap: Creating a step-by-step plan for upgrades and system enhancements ensures your business adopts the right tools at the right time without incurring unnecessary costs.
- Aligning IT with Business Goals: Whether you’re looking to scale operations, enter new markets, or enhance customer experiences, aligning your IT strategy with business goals makes every investment more impactful.
- Comprehensive IT Asset Management: Managing hardware and software lifecycles ensures you can plan upgrades or replacements before disruptions occur.
- End-User Support and Training: Training your team to confidently use new systems boosts productivity, while ongoing support resolves technical issues efficiently.
2. Cybersecurity Services
With increasing cyber threats, robust cybersecurity is a top priority for small businesses to protect their data and reputation. Key components of cybersecurity services include:
- Risk Assessments: Identifying vulnerabilities in your IT infrastructure, such as outdated systems or weak access controls, to create a focused security plan.
- Incident Response Planning: Establishing clear protocols for detecting, containing, and recovering from cyber incidents to minimize downtime and data loss.
- Network Security: Implementing firewalls, intrusion detection, and real-time monitoring to prevent unauthorized access and threats.
- Endpoint Protection: Securing devices like laptops, mobile phones, and tablets with advanced antivirus and anti-malware solutions to ensure organization-wide safety.

3. Cloud Integration
Cloud computing is an essential tool for businesses today. If you seek flexibility, scalability, and cost savings in your business IT system, consider:
- Cloud Migration Strategies: Assessing existing infrastructure to identify the best data and applications for cloud migration while minimizing disruptions.
- Hybrid and Multi-Cloud Solutions: Combining public, private, and on-premises systems to achieve the right balance of security, scalability, and cost-efficiency.
- Cloud Security: Protecting cloud data with encryption, access controls, and other measures to safeguard against breaches and unauthorized access.
- Ongoing Cloud Management: Continuous updates, performance optimization, and troubleshooting ensure smooth cloud operations tailored to business growth.

4. Data Protection Services
Data is the lifeblood of any business, and its loss can lead to operational disruptions, reputational damage, and legal consequences. Data protection consultancy focuses on ensuring business-critical data is secure, accessible, and recoverable.
- Backup and Recovery Solutions: Implementing automated, scheduled backups and rapid recovery systems to minimize downtime in case of accidental deletions, hardware failures, or cyberattacks.
- Disaster Recovery Planning: Designing a recovery plan to ensure continuity during unforeseen events like server crashes or natural disasters.
- Data Encryption: Applying encryption to sensitive data both in transit and at rest to prevent unauthorized access.
- Compliance Assistance: Helping businesses meet legal and regulatory requirements, such as Malaysia’s Personal Data Protection Act (PDPA).

5. Network Setup and Management
A reliable and secure network forms the backbone of efficient business operations. Network consultancy services typically focus on:
- Designing Scalable Networks: Creating a network architecture that can grow with your business, accommodating new users and devices without frequent overhauls.
- Implementing Redundant Systems: Establishing backup systems and failover protocols to keep your network operational during outages or hardware failures.
- Network Security: Using firewalls, segmentation, and real-time monitoring to protect against threats while maintaining data integrity.
- Server Management and Optimization: Regular maintenance, updates, and load balancing ensure your network performs efficiently, even during peak demand.

Where and How Do I Start?
Taking the first step with IT consultancy doesn’t need to be intimidating. A structured approach will help you streamline the process and make the most of your investment.
1. Identifying Business Needs
The first step is to understand what your business truly needs from an IT perspective. Start by identifying any specific IT challenges that might be slowing down operations or posing risks.
For example, are you dealing with outdated software that doesn’t meet your current needs? Are there security concerns, or is your network performance slowing down productivity? Defining these issues will give you clarity on the areas where IT consultancy can offer tangible solutions.
It’s also essential to look at your long-term business objectives. Where do you see your business in the next few years? Aligning your IT goals with your overall business vision ensures that any changes you implement now will support growth down the road.
2. Budgeting for Services
Once you’ve identified your needs, consider the financial aspect. Understanding pricing models in IT consultancy is crucial since costs can vary depending on the service level and expertise required. Familiarize yourself with different pricing structures, such as hourly rates, project-based fees, or ongoing support subscriptions, so you can select a model that fits your budget.
Allocate funds efficiently by focusing on solutions that directly address your needs and offer significant value. Prioritize essential improvements, like enhancing security or optimizing performance, and reserve a portion of your budget for future upgrades or ongoing support.
3. Gathering IT Infrastructure Information
Before your first consultation, take the time to review and document your current technology setup. Begin with a full inventory of your hardware and software assets. This step will give the consultant a clear picture of your existing tools and systems, which is essential for pinpointing areas that need upgrading or replacing.
Additionally, document your business workflows to understand where technology can help streamline operations.
Look at the manual tasks that could be automated or systems that could be improved to reduce errors and improve efficiency. With this information in hand, you’ll be better prepared to discuss practical solutions with your consultant.
4. Setting the Right Expectations During IT Consultancy
To get the most out of IT consultancy, set realistic expectations about the process and outcomes. Start with a clear plan for implementing new systems, allowing the consultant to focus on technical details while you continue running your business smoothly. This way, disruptions are minimized, and you can maintain focus on core operations.
Next, consider training your staff on any new systems or software. Ensure the consultant or IT provider includes training sessions, so your team can confidently use the tools introduced. Training not only promotes a smoother transition but also helps maximize the effectiveness of new technology.
5. Ongoing Support & Performance Reviews
Ongoing support is another critical factor. Set up a plan for continuous assistance even after the initial implementation. This could be an on-call support service or regular check-ins to handle any emerging issues, keeping your systems running optimally.
Finally, make it a point to conduct regular performance reviews.
Schedule periodic evaluations with your IT consultant to measure how well the new systems are supporting your business objectives. These check-ins allow you to address any needed adjustments promptly, ensuring your technology continues to add value as your business evolves.
